The Importance of Consistency in Investing

Many investors struggle with constantly changing their investment strategy in an attempt to improve returns. This approach, however, often prevents investments from gaining long-term momentum. Frequent shifts in direction interrupt compounding, create confusion, and make it difficult to judge whether any strategy was given enough time to work properly.

Consistency in investing requires a certain level of patience from an individual. Markets and financial strategies take time to operate, and constant changes in direction prevent an investor from developing and increasing profits over time. Approaches that were supposed to generate money over the next few years are often abandoned due to short-term disappointment.

The Impact of Short-Term Noises on Investors' Decision Making

The abundance of information on financial markets creates significant pressure when making decisions. Those who modify their approaches to investing frequently tend to do so based on short-term performance of particular sectors. As a result, assets are often purchased at high prices and sold at low prices.

This leads to a fragmented portfolio, where assets overlap or belong to opposite investment classes, and some assets may be designed for totally different goals. It becomes increasingly difficult to understand what investors want to achieve with such a portfolio, and a decline in efficiency is likely to occur.

Fragmented Portfolios and the Compounding Effect

Frequent modification of a financial strategy interferes with the natural compounding effect, which is a key aspect of long-term investing. Money left in investments are likely to start earning themselves, but constant interference prevents this process from developing. Even the strongest and most solid investments are not able to provide profits in case of constant interference.

Patience becomes critical for developing a compounding effect, which is essential for long-term success. Investors should be consistent with their chosen direction for a longer period of time to gain more confidence.

The Advantage of Long-Term Consistency

Long-term success usually involves maintaining the chosen direction for years regardless of changes in financial markets. This does not mean that people will neglect the existing changes and remain passive. A carefully developed approach can give investors proper guidance for investing, and periodical reviews will allow them to make alterations in their plans if required.

Investor Takeaway

Investors should adopt a consistent approach to investing and avoid frequent portfolio overhauls to achieve long-term success.
